Newcastle are set to make a formal offer for Aston Villa's Jacob Ramsey, and it's about bloody time too! Villa are willing to sell their academy graduate to comply with those bullshit UEFA Financial Fair Play rules.

Ramsey is keen on a move to St. James' Park after rejecting interest from those muppets at West Ham earlier this summer. The lad has been at Villa since he was six, but his chances of regular game time have gone down the shitter in recent seasons.

Last season, he made 29 Premier League appearances but only completed the full 90 minutes twice. The former England under-21 international also chipped in with four goals and seven assists across all competitions last term, but apparently that's not good enough for Villa.

Ramsey has two years left on his contract at Villa Park but hasn't been able to agree terms on a new deal. Villa legend Gabby Agbonlahor reckons the midfielder will be missed if he leaves, but what does he know?

Ramsey 'will be missed'

Agbonlahor reacted to the news of Ramsey's potential departure on Breakfast, saying: "What can you do as a club when the talks are that they've offered three contracts, he's turned them down, and his contract expires in June 2027? That's two years left.

"If you don't sell now and this carries on into January, 18 months left, what sort of offer are you going to get?

"So Aston Villa are probably looking at it and saying, listen, if he's not going to sign a new contract on the terms that we have given him, then we need to sell now and make some money.

"And some fans have been tweeting me and saying, Gabby, it's a good deal. He only scored one Premier League goal last season.

"I don't look at him as a natural goal scorer, but I think he will be missed. One of our own, local lad.

"The way he can carry that ball and create chances for others as well, he'll be a big miss and a great signing for Newcastle."

Villa host Newcastle in their opening match of the new Premier League season on Saturday. If Ramsey completes a move to Tyneside, he would become the Magpies' third summer signing, joining German defender Malick Thiaw, Anthony Elanga and Aaron Ramsdale.
